Low Platelet Count Symptoms: 7 Warning Signs

Low platelet count symptoms

If you’re searching for low platelet count symptoms, you’re likely noticing something off — unexplained bruises, bleeding gums, or maybe a lab result that flagged something abnormal. The most common symptoms of a low platelet count (medically called thrombocytopenia) include easy bruising, tiny reddish-purple spots on the skin called petechiae, prolonged bleeding from minor cuts, frequent nosebleeds, heavy periods, and blood in your urine or stool. Many people have no symptoms at all until their count drops below 50,000/µL.

Here’s the thing most articles won’t tell you: the symptoms you experience depend almost entirely on how low your platelets actually are. A count of 120,000/µL might cause zero symptoms. A count of 10,000/µL is a medical emergency. Let me walk you through exactly what to watch for at each level.

What Counts as a Low Platelet Count?

A normal platelet count ranges from 150,000 to 400,000 platelets per microliter (µL) of blood. Anything below 150,000/µL technically qualifies as thrombocytopenia, but most people don’t feel a thing until the number drops significantly lower.

Platelet Count (per µL) Severity Typical Symptoms Bleeding Risk
100,000–150,000 Mild Usually none Minimal — surgery may still be safe
50,000–99,000 Moderate Easy bruising, prolonged bleeding from cuts Increased with trauma or surgery
20,000–49,000 Severe Petechiae, nosebleeds, gum bleeding, heavy periods Spontaneous bleeding possible
Below 20,000 Critical Spontaneous bruising, internal bleeding risk High — risk of intracranial hemorrhage
Below 10,000 Life-threatening Spontaneous mucosal and internal bleeding Very high — emergency treatment needed

The 7 Warning Signs of Low Platelets

1. Easy or Unexplained Bruising

This is the symptom that brings most patients into my office. The bruises tend to appear on the arms, legs, and trunk without any memorable injury. They may be larger than usual and take longer to resolve. Doctors call this purpura when the bruised patches exceed about 3mm in diameter.

2. Petechiae — Tiny Red or Purple Dots on the Skin

Petechiae are pinpoint-sized (1–2mm) reddish-purple spots, often clustered on the lower legs, ankles, or inside the mouth. Unlike a rash, they don’t blanch (turn white) when you press on them. This is one of the most specific signs of a platelet problem — if you see them, get a blood count done.

3. Prolonged Bleeding from Cuts or Scrapes

A small kitchen cut that won’t stop oozing after 10–15 minutes of pressure warrants attention. Platelets form the initial “plug” in wound healing, so when they’re low, even superficial wounds take noticeably longer to clot.

4. Frequent Nosebleeds

Occasional nosebleeds are common, especially in dry climates. But nosebleeds that occur multiple times per week, last longer than 20 minutes, or involve both nostrils may signal thrombocytopenia.

5. Bleeding Gums

Gums that bleed during brushing can be a dental issue — but gums that bleed spontaneously, or bleed heavily after gentle brushing, point more toward a platelet or coagulation problem.

6. Heavy Menstrual Periods

Menorrhagia (abnormally heavy periods) is one of the most underrecognized symptoms of low platelets in women. Soaking through a pad or tampon every hour, periods lasting longer than 7 days, or passing large clots should prompt a CBC. Studies suggest up to 10–20% of women evaluated for heavy menstrual bleeding have an underlying bleeding disorder.

7. Blood in Urine or Stool

This is a more alarming sign and usually indicates a platelet count below 20,000–30,000/µL. Blood in the stool can appear bright red or dark and tarry. Pink or red-tinged urine (hematuria) also warrants immediate evaluation.

What Causes Low Platelet Count?

Thrombocytopenia falls into three main categories based on the underlying mechanism:

  • Decreased production: Bone marrow disorders like leukemia, aplastic anemia, myelodysplastic syndromes, B12 or folate deficiency, heavy alcohol use, viral infections (hepatitis C, HIV)
  • Increased destruction: Immune thrombocytopenic purpura (ITP), thrombotic thrombocytopenic purpura (TTP), disseminated intravascular coagulation (DIC), heparin-induced thrombocytopenia (HIT)
  • Sequestration or dilution: Enlarged spleen (hypersplenism) from liver cirrhosis, massive blood transfusions

Medications are another major culprit. Common offenders include heparin, certain antibiotics (linezolid, vancomycin), chemotherapy drugs, and even over-the-counter medications like quinine (found in tonic water).

How Is Low Platelet Count Diagnosed?

The starting point is a complete blood count (CBC) — a simple blood draw your doctor can order in minutes. If the platelet count comes back low, the next steps typically include:

  • Peripheral blood smear: A technician looks at your blood under a microscope to check platelet size and rule out clumping (pseudothrombocytopenia — a lab artifact that falsely lowers the count)
  • Reticulocyte count and LDH: To assess whether red blood cells are also being destroyed
  • Liver and kidney function tests: Organ dysfunction is a common contributing cause
  • Autoimmune panels: ANA, anti-platelet antibodies if ITP is suspected
  • Bone marrow biopsy: Reserved for cases where the cause remains unclear or malignancy is suspected

One practical tip: if your count comes back mildly low (say, 130,000–145,000/µL) on a single test, your doctor will likely repeat it before doing an extensive workup. Mild fluctuations are common and don’t always indicate disease.

When to See a Doctor — Don’t Wait on These

Go to the emergency room if you experience:

  • Sudden, severe headache with petechiae (could indicate intracranial bleeding)
  • Heavy, uncontrolled bleeding from any site
  • Large areas of purpura spreading rapidly
  • Black, tarry stools or vomiting blood

Schedule a doctor’s visit this week if you notice:

  • New, unexplained bruises appearing regularly
  • Petechiae on your legs or inside your cheeks
  • Nosebleeds happening more than twice a week
  • Periods that are significantly heavier than your normal

Frequently Asked Questions

Can low platelet count symptoms come and go?

Yes, especially in ITP, the most common autoimmune cause of low platelets in adults. Platelet counts can fluctuate, and symptoms may worsen during viral illnesses or periods of stress, then improve spontaneously. Chronic ITP is defined as lasting beyond 12 months.

What platelet count is dangerously low?

Most hematologists consider a count below 20,000/µL dangerous and below 10,000/µL a medical emergency. At these levels, spontaneous bleeding — including life-threatening intracranial hemorrhage — can occur without any trauma.

Can food or supplements raise platelet count?

If your low count is caused by a nutritional deficiency (B12, folate, or iron), correcting that deficiency will raise your platelets. But there’s no strong evidence that specific “superfoods” meaningfully boost platelets in people with ITP, bone marrow disorders, or other non-nutritional causes. Don’t rely on papaya leaf extract or similar supplements as a substitute for medical treatment.

Does low platelet count always mean something serious?

No. Mild thrombocytopenia (100,000–150,000/µL) is fairly common and often incidental. Pregnancy alone causes a mild drop in about 5–10% of women (gestational thrombocytopenia), and it typically resolves after delivery without treatment. However, a persistently dropping count or a count below 100,000/µL always deserves investigation.

Can I exercise with low platelets?

It depends on the severity. With counts above 50,000/µL, low-impact exercise like walking or swimming is generally safe. Below 50,000/µL, avoid contact sports and heavy weightlifting. Below 20,000/µL, most hematologists recommend limiting physical activity until the count improves, as even minor trauma could cause significant bleeding.
